In the leave type edit screen, locate the option Is a supporting document or attachment required for this leave application?.
Choose Yes to enforce attachment uploads when employees apply for this leave type (e.g., hospitalisation leave requiring a medical cert).
Once enabled, the system prompts employees to attach files before the leave request can be submitted.
Within the same leave type edit screen, find the setting Should public holidays and rest days be included when applying for this leave?
Set it to Yes if this leave type should count holidays and rest days toward leave (e.g., maternity leave spanning public holidays).
This setting determines if the leave calculation includes or excludes these non‑working days.
